What is the "Slippery Slope Fallacy"?

A slippery slope fallacy occurs when a prediction is made about a series of circumstances that would eventually lead to a big event, typically a bad circumstance. According to this fallacy, one thing happens, then another, and so on, bringing us to a dreadful result. The incorrect logic advances with each step or occurrence at an increasingly improbable rate.

For instance, if you don't pass the arithmetic test tomorrow, you won't be allowed to take calculus next year.

What is the narrative of Arachne's major lesson?

Finding for Surely Athena

Arachne is mostly a tale about pride and human frailty. Arachne is an exceptionally gifted weaver who thrives on the adoration of her customers. Arachne eventually boasts that her weaving is even better than Athena's due to her youth and inexperience as well as her awareness of her exceptional talents.
